In our Spiritual Experience Mount Moriah Becomes Mount Zion, the Reality of the Body

Hebrews 12:22-23 But you have come forward to Mount Zion and to the city of the living God, the heavenly Jerusalem; and to myriads of angels, to the universal gathering; And to the church of the firstborn, who have been enrolled in the heavens; and to God, the Judge of all; and to the spirits of righteous men who have been made perfect.

The God of Abraham is our God, and Abraham’s experience of God needs to become our experience of God also. One of the deepest and highest experiences Abraham had of God was at Mount Moriah, where God instructed him to go and bring his son, Isaac, as a burnt offering to Him.

God tested Abraham in this way, asking him to offer his beloved son whom He promised and He brought forth in Abraham’s old age. God wanted Abraham to rely NOT on his son (even God promised Isaac to him) but on God alone.

Furthermore, God didn’t want to take Isaac from Abraham; rather, God wanted to return Isaac to Abraham in resurrection in a multiplied way for the blessing of all the nations.

As for Mount Moriah, the place of God’s choice for the offering up of Isaac, this mountain eventually became Mount Zion, the site of the temple and the centre of the good land (see Gen. 22:2, 14; 2 Chron 3:1).

In our spiritual experience, Mount Moriah (the place of God’s choice for the offering of our Isaac to God) needs to become Mount Zion, the highest peak in God’s economy, the vital groups as the reality of the Body of Christ.

In a very real sense though, there’s nothing that WE can do to reach Mount Zion except to pray and do our best to cooperate with the Lord.

It is God who initiates our salvation, He calls us out of anything else, He draws us to Himself, He brings us in the good land, He appears to us again and again, and He calls us to go to Mount Moriah – when He sees that we are ready for it.

He calls, He supplies, and He does everything in us and for us for the fulfillment of His purpose. We simply need to give Him our best cooperation through prayer, opening to Him and giving Him a way in our being.

May the Lord gain the reality of the Body of Christ, the vital groups within all the local churches on earth, for Him to have a built-up Body which becomes the prepared Bride to bring Him back!

Mount Moriah Becomes Mount Zion in our Experience

God told Abraham to offer up Isaac on a specific mountain in the land of Moriah. This mount Moriah is the place of God’s choice (Gen. 22:2-2). Abraham did everything according to God’s revelation.

Mount Moriah eventually became Mount Zion, the center of the city of Jerusalem, the more elevated place in Jerusalem where the temple was built. God asked His people that three times a year all males would go up to Jerusalem to worship God in His temple and feast in His presence (Deut. 16:16; Psa. 132:13).

Abraham’s earthly descendants had to go three times a year to Mount Moriah, that is, Mount Zion, where they would offer God their burnt offerings.

Today we as the spiritual descendants of Abraham have come to Mount Zion (Heb. 12:22-23), and eventually, we will all join Abraham to worship God on the eternal mount Zion, the New Jerusalem. The entire New Jerusalem is Zion, the Holy of Holies, the place where God is we will be forever (Rev. 14:1-5; 21:22).

What Abraham did in Genesis 22 is the seed, what the Jews are told by God to do (going to Jerusalem 3 times a year) is a development of the seed, what we are today is the manifestation of this seed, and the New Jerusalem will be the full harvest of this seed.

As we enjoy the Lord as the living water and the eternal life in Beer-Sheba in the church life, growing in life and enjoying the divine life, the Lord will one day call us to go to Mount Moriah to offer up our Isaac to Him.

This journey is a deeply personal journey, and the God who calls us to offer up our Isaac will also inwardly supply us to do this. But after our Isaac has been offered and returned to us in resurrection, Mount Moriah becomes to us Mount Zion, the reality of the Body of Christ.

Then and there we will realize that we are not there alone: there are many people on this mountain, many who went ahead of us and some who are there with us, those who have walked in the steps of our father Abraham.

In reality and experience, Mount Moriah becomes to us Mount Zion, the site of the building up of God’s temple, His dwelling place.

All we need to do is stay in Beer-Sheba, enjoy the Lord, grow in life, until the Lord will take us to Mount Moriah. Wherever we are, we should be what we are until the divine life will make us something else and bring us somewhere else.
